one. Cotton
Cotton is Among the most commonly used organic fabrics on the earth. It is gentle, breathable, and extremely absorbent, rendering it ideal for day-to-day clothing, property textiles, and youngsters's put on.
Very best For: T-shirts, bedsheets, undergarments
Pros: Comfy, hypoallergenic, biodegradable
Downsides: Wrinkles easily, may shrink just after washing
two. Silk
Silk is an opulent all-natural fiber noted for its sleek texture and glossy look. It’s very prized for formalwear and substantial-conclude fashion because of its elegance and delicate drape.
Ideal For: Night gowns, scarves, lingerie
Professionals: Light-weight, lustrous, normal temperature regulation
Downsides: Costly, sensitive, requires dry cleaning
3. Linen
Made out of the flax plant, linen is often a breathable, purely natural fabric perfect for heat climates. It's got a crisp texture along with a calm, easy search.
Ideal For: Summer months dresses, trousers, tablecloths
Execs: Resilient, moisture-wicking, eco-friendly
Drawbacks: Wrinkles very easily, may well really feel rigid in the beginning
four. Wool
Wool is really a heat, insulating fabric derived from your fleece of animals like sheep, alpacas, and goats. It’s perfect for chilly temperature garments and comes in a variety of varieties including cashmere and merino.
Finest For: Coats, suits, sweaters
Execs: Superb insulation, breathable, h2o-resistant
Drawbacks: May be itchy, shrinks in very hot drinking water, demands Unique care
five. Polyester
Polyester is a man-designed synthetic cloth noted for its power, longevity, and wrinkle resistance. It is often Utilized in the two fashion and home décor.
Finest For: Sportswear, upholstery, blends
Pros: Very affordable, rapid-drying, wrinkle-no cost
Negatives: Significantly less breathable, non-biodegradable
6. Rayon
Rayon is often a semi-artificial fabric made out of cellulose. It mimics the texture of silk, cotton, or wool and it is known for its versatility and luxury.
Very best For: Dresses, linings, blouses
Professionals: Soft, drapes well, breathable
Downsides: Can shrink, weak when damp
seven. Nylon
Nylon is a artificial fabric known for its elasticity, power, and resistance to abrasion. It really is frequently Utilized in activewear and outerwear.
Greatest For: Swimwear, stockings, out of doors equipment
Professionals: Light-weight, h2o-resistant, sturdy
Cons: Not eco-helpful, can entice warmth
eight. Velvet
Velvet is usually a plush, woven material noted for its magnificent texture and abundant physical appearance. Usually created from silk, it’s now often blended with artificial fibers.
Very best For: Evening have on, upholstery, Wintertime attire
Pros: Classy, tender, significant visual enchantment
Disadvantages: May be significant, click here tricky to clean up
nine. Denim
Denim is a durable cotton twill material, commonly Utilized in relaxed and workwear. Recognized for its durability, it’s a vogue staple across generations.
Ideal For: Denims, jackets, skirts
Professionals: Solid, classy, long-lasting
Cons: May be rigid, fades eventually
10. Chiffon
Chiffon is a lightweight, sheer cloth frequently comprised of silk, polyester, or nylon. It's a comfortable drape and is particularly accustomed to add elegance to clothes.
Ideal For: Evening gowns, bridal use, blouses
Pros: Airy, passionate, fluid movement
Negatives: Delicate, susceptible to snagging
